You're ambitious, but feel you've never been given full permission to find and strive for what's possible for you. You've achieved things in your career, and it's now time to "climb the second mountain" and think about legacy. You're unhappy with how the world is working right now, and you want to change your part of it for the better. You're a coach, and you want to support your clients to be great and do great things. You're at the start of your adult life, and you're fired up to live a life of meaning and impact. You're ready to begin, and to start doing something that matters. We unlock our greatness by working on the hard things.
With The Coaching Habit, Michael Bungay Stanier wrote the bestselling coaching book of the century. With The Advice Trap, he showed you how to tame your Advice Monster. Now, he's here to help you reclaim your ambition, figure out what you should do that matters... and begin. This is your practical guide to finding the focus and courage to set a Worthy Goal: one that lights you up, compels you to grow, and serves a bigger game by being thrilling, important, and daunting. With Michael's trademark humor, compassion, and laser-focused clarity, you'll walk through a tested process to:
- find and strengthen your Worthy Goal to the very best it can be;
- get absolutely clear on your commitment so you know what you're up for;
- develop the resources to cross the threshold, so you don't have to travel alone;
- build momentum, progress, and impact. Don't regret a life half-lived. Use this book to start doing something that matters. *** "Piercingly frank, funny, gorgeous, vulnerable, and ultimately really damn helpful."
